Nicholas Stefanelli leaves AIK for Inter Miami

Now it’s over.

Nicolas Stefanelli leaves AIK for David Beckham’s Inter Miami.

– It was very difficult to make this decision, he told the club’s website.

Sportbladet has previously revealed that Nicolás Stefanelli will leave AIK for David Beckham’s Inter Miami club. And now the deal has been confirmed by AIK.

– Dear AIK members. Playing in front of 50,000 people chanting “Argentina, Argentina” and receiving so much love, on and off the field, are things I never imagined I would experience in my career. Today I have to say goodbye. It was very difficult to make this decision, but I know that the future will bring us together again. Thank you to each and every one of you for all the love for me and my family, it’s been an amazing four beautiful years that I will never forget. Memories that I will carry with me wherever I travel. Heads high, back straight, we’re AIK,” Stefanelli tells the club’s website.

In total, there have been 36 goals in 92 Allsvenskan matches for the Argentine, who won SM gold with the club in 2018.

– Nico is not only a great footballer, he’s also a great person. When this opportunity presented itself to Niko, and while he wanted to take the opportunity to try his luck, it was clear to us to find a solution that would work for all parties. Niko stands for AIK in many ways, and the club’s love is mutual. We hope to be able to welcome him back to AIK in some form in the future, says Manuel Lindberg, Executive Director / Club Director and Acting Sporting Director.
